SpaceX Goes Exclusive on Nvidia: The 260x Multiplier Reshaping AI Compute Economics

CryptoNeo
SpaceX just signed an exclusive AI infrastructure deal with Nvidia. Shares moved 4% on the news โ€” roughly $130 billion in market capitalization โ€” for a contract that, even at the most generous public estimates, likely represents less than 0.3% of Nvidia's annual data center revenue. Do the math: that's a 260x multiplier between the event's direct financial weight and the market's response. Institutional investors aren't pricing the contract. They're pricing the vertical. And they might be right โ€” but for reasons that have nothing to do with the contract itself. The word "exclusive" is doing heavy lifting here. SpaceX builds its own rockets, its own satellites, its own ground stations. Yet it just conceded its entire AI compute route to an external vendor. No AMD Instinct. No Intel Gaudi. No Tesla Dojo. No in-house silicon. For the most engineering-autonomous company in America, that is an admission with significant consequences. Speed is the only currency that doesn't inflate. Let's anchor what "Nvidia AI systems" actually means. It's not a single product. It's a full-stack lock-in mechanism: DGX SuperPOD clusters for model training, HGX/IGX platforms for edge inference, Omniverse for digital-twin simulation, and CUDA as the connective tissue binding it all together. Mapping that stack to SpaceX's operational surface is straightforward. The company manages a Starlink constellation exceeding 6,000 satellites, requiring automated collision avoidance, beamforming optimization, and network traffic prediction. It iterates Starship at a pace demanding heavy launch and re-entry simulation. Those workloads map directly to DGX for training and Omniverse for simulation โ€” I've audited infrastructure positioning for comparable-scale industrial AI adopters, and this product mapping is the only rational fit. Here's a detail most coverage misses: SpaceX has no public record of large-scale GPU procurement before this announcement. Historically, its simulation infrastructure ran on CPU-based HPC clusters. "Exclusive" therefore signals a clean sweep โ€” full ecosystem adoption, not a pilot program. The cost range is equally instructive. A single DGX SuperPOD runs between $100 million and $500 million. Multiple clusters scale into the billions. The market doesn't know the actual number. The 4% jump is a bet that "SpaceX exclusive" becomes "aerospace AI default" โ€” a thesis, not a reported figure. Four findings structure my read on this event. First: this is counter-cyclical revenue insurance. Nvidia's data center segment generates roughly 88% of total revenue, with hyperscalers โ€” Microsoft, Amazon, Google โ€” contributing half of that. Hyperscaler spending is credit-cycle sensitive. Aerospace and defense procurement is not. SpaceX serves as a beachhead into a procurement category that historically buys first and audits later. Follow-on contracts with Lockheed Martin and Northrop Grumman are now a probability-weighted expectation, not speculative upside. That is how you defend a premium multiple against a cyclical AI capex pullback. Second: the Musk paradox cuts deeper than headlines suggest. Musk publicly griped in 2024 that Nvidia GPUs were "harder to get than drugs." Tesla built Dojo and the D1/D2 chip line specifically to escape Nvidia dependency. SpaceX choosing Nvidia anyway โ€” while Tesla continues its self-developed path โ€” confirms an internal portfolio strategy: each business unit picks the compute solution that minimizes mission risk. When the payload is a Starship carrying billion-dollar infrastructure, you don't gamble on unproven silicon. Compliance with physical reality trumps ideological preference. Third: supply chain pressure amplifies across the AI economy. If SpaceX deploys at SuperPOD scale โ€” I estimate 2,000 to 8,000 GPUs based on comparable enterprise commitments and Starlink's telemetry processing demands โ€” this draws directly against constrained HBM supply, TSMC's CoWoS packaging capacity, and liquid-cooling production. Every mission-critical customer that locks in Nvidia capacity converts scarcity from a cyclical to a structural feature. For crypto-AI projects relying on rented GPU capacity โ€” Render, Akash, IO.net, Gensyn-style compute markets โ€” this is a direct cost pressure signal. I spent late 2024 stress-testing GPU rental economics across centralized and decentralized providers for my trading models. The pricing asymmetry I found โ€” tokenized compute trading at 40-60% discounts to AWS despite comparable hardware โ€” tells you the market is pricing utilization uncertainty, not hardware value. This SpaceX deal doesn't fix that discount; it entrenches it. On-chain compute pricing doesn't trend downward when the largest aerospace company in America signs an exclusivity agreement. Fourth: the valuation math is stretched but coherent. A $130 billion market cap increase against a potential $500 million contract is a 260x narrative multiplier. Markets front-run theses; that's structurally normal. But this creates asymmetric reversal risk if contract disclosures reveal smaller numbers than expectations. The vertical market thesis is sound. The specific figures remain unverified. Data first. Narrative second. Only the tape remembers. Here's what the coverage is missing โ€” and it cuts against my own industry's grain. This deal is a bearish signal for decentralized AI compute networks. The decentralized GPU thesis argues that centralized infrastructure is expensive, bottlenecked, and rent-extractive. The argument has intellectual merit. Yet SpaceX โ€” the most engineering-driven company on Earth, founded by a man who publicly mocked Nvidia's supply constraints and built his own chip program โ€” chose the most centralized AI vendor available. When the standard-bearer for radical engineering independence signs an exclusivity clause with the incumbent, it hardens the maturity gap between centralized and decentralized infrastructure. The decentralized "rent is too high" argument only compels when a credible alternative exists. At the mission-critical tier, it doesn't. Tokenized compute markets have a demand discovery problem, not a supply problem โ€” and this decision just deferred institutional validation of that thesis indefinitely. The second blind spot is meta. Crypto Briefing โ€” a crypto-native outlet โ€” publishing a SpaceX/Nvidia story as market-moving coverage reveals the capital-flow correlation between AI equities and crypto assets. When Nvidia pumps, risk appetite concentrates in US tech equities. That's a liquidity drain vector for crypto markets. The "AI and crypto rise together" narrative conflates thematic adjacency with capital-flow reality. Often, AI gains and crypto bleeds. Speed beats sentiment โ€” but only if it's pointed in the right direction. Watch the follow-on disclosure cycle. If Lockheed or Northrop announces Nvidia adoption within twelve months, the aerospace AI vertical is captured โ€” and the 4% move was cheap. If contract specifics reveal small-scale numbers, expect retracement. For the decentralized compute thesis: treat this as a wake-up call, not a death sentence. The gap closes with execution, not narrative. But it closes slower than the market's current bet assumes.
